A vulnerability was found in code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0 in /Scheduling/pages/profileupdate.php. Manipulating the parameter username will cause SQL injection attacks.
A vulnerability was found in Code-Proj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0 in the file /Scheduling/pages/classsave.php. Manipulation of parameter class will lead to SQL injection attacks.
A vulnerability has been discovered in the code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0. The issue affects some unknown features in the file /Scheduling/pages/classsched.php. Manipulating the class parameter can lead to cross-site scripting (XSS).
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0. Affected is an unknown function of the file /pages/salutdel.php. The manipulation of the argument id leads to sql injection.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, has been found in code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0. This issue affects some unknown processing of the file /pages/activate.php. The manipulation of the argument id leads to sql injection.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
Code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System V1.0 is vulnerable to Cross Site Scripting (XSS) in /pages/room.php via the id and rome parameters.
Code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System V1.0 is vulnerable to Cross Site Scripting (XSS) in /pages/program.php via the id, code, and name parameters.
Code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System V1.0 is vulnerable to Cross Site Scripting (XSS) in profile.php via the memberfirst and memberlast parameters.
Code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0 is vulnerable to SQL Injection in examsave.php via the parameters member and first.
Code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System V1.0 is vulnerable to Cross Site Scripting (XSS) in /pages/class.php via the id and cys parameters.
A vulnerability was found in code-projects Online Class and Exam Scheduling System 1.0. It has been rated as problematic. Affected by this issue is some unknown functionality of the file /Scheduling/scheduling/pages/profile.php. The manipulation of the argument username leads to cross site scripting.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
